Operation Panel At present, the woodworking machine system is divided into four major systems: MW2200, MW2800, MW2900 and MW5800. Among them, MW2800 and MW2900 are the same series. Therefore, they are only divided into three series actually, and each series has some differences with others.

Network disk import / export Users can directly import the machining program from the computer to the system or export the machining program in the system to the computer through the sharing method of network disk. It's required to set the computer IP and computer folder name to provide the shared folder on the system.

The system provides quick restore and backup functions, allowing the machinery factory to set the factory default value when the machine is shipped. When the user is in operation error, it can quickly restore the factory default value of the machiney factory, reducing the need for personnel to be on-site for after-sales service.

Positioning 1. The system provides a total of 6 sets of positioning controls, which can be used by the user for related positioning, or for side pushing or back pushing during the loading and unloading actions.

Error! Use the Start tab to apply “Title 1” to the text need to be displayed here. Axis group configuration: Set the corresponding path of each axis, hardware axis number and axis name. Setting of each axis: Set the relevant parameters of each axial direction, for example: whether to use encoder, drive command format, origin searching method, etc.
